Morocco Joins International Arab League of Legends Championship

The North African country is making strides in leveling up its video gaming sector.

Mrirt – Morocco is taking part in the International Arab League of Legends Championship, which kicked off Friday and is being hosted by the Emirates Federation for Electronic Sports.

Launched in partnership with the Arab Middle East for Esports company, the tournament also features teams from the United Arab Emirates, Egypt, Lebanon, Syria, Tunisia, as well as squads from Montenegro and Austria, according to a Federation statement.

The Federation’s Secretary General, Saeed Ali Al Taher, said that the competition is poised to enhance Arab players’ experience and sharpen their skills to prepare for their participation in major international championships.

The opening day schedule includes the competition’s quarter-final matches, with Syria facing Tunisia in the first game, followed by Morocco taking on Montenegro. Egypt will meet Austria, while the United Arab Emirates will compete against Lebanon.

Morocco’s growing gaming sector

Morocco’s gaming sector has been growing as the government continues to invest efforts in developing this nascent sector in the country.

The Moroccan government has recently approved a new decree that significantly expanded the responsibilities of its Communications Department to include gaming. The decree is set to develop plans to grow the country’s video game industry.

The North African country organized the first Morocco Exhibition for Electronic Games Industry in May 2024, aiming to foster the industry and demonstrate its technical, financial, and educational components.

Reports show Morocco’s flourishing investment in the video gaming sector. A recent report from the German statistics website Statista indicated that the country’s business in the field is expected to increase at an annual rate of 9.39% between 2024 and 2027. According to Statista, the country’s sales figures will namely jump from $227.3 million in 2024 to $297.5 million by 2027.
